 On 26.10.2022 12:20, Andrew Cooper wrote:
> --- /dev/null
> +++ b/tools/tests/p2m-pool/Makefile
> @@ -0,0 +1,42 @@
> +XEN_ROOT = $(CURDIR)/../../..
> +include $(XEN_ROOT)/tools/Rules.mk
> +
> +TARGET := test-p2m-pool
> +
> +.PHONY: all
> +all: $(TARGET)
> +
> +.PHONY: clean
> +clean:
> +     $(RM) -- *.o $(TARGET) $(DEPS_RM)
> +
> +.PHONY: distclean
> +distclean: clean
> +     $(RM) -- *~
> +
> +.PHONY: install
> +install: all
> +     $(INSTALL_DIR) $(DESTDIR)$(LIBEXEC_BIN)
> +     $(INSTALL_PROG) $(TARGET) $(DESTDIR)$(LIBEXEC_BIN)
> +
> +.PHONY: uninstall
> +uninstall:
> +     $(RM) -- $(DESTDIR)$(LIBEXEC_BIN)/$(TARGET)
> +
> +CFLAGS += $(CFLAGS_xeninclude)
> +CFLAGS += $(CFLAGS_libxenctrl)
> +CFLAGS += $(CFLAGS_libxenforeginmemory)
Typo here or typo also elsewhere: CFLAGS_libxenforeignmemory? I
have to admit that I can't really spot where these variables are
populated. The place in Rules.mk that I could spot uses
 CFLAGS_libxen$(1) = $$(CFLAGS_xeninclude)
i.e. the expansion doesn't really depend on the library.
Apart from this looks okay to me, maybe apart from ...
